I am currently storing the thread id within the message index, however, 
although this would allow me to sort, it doesn't help with the grouping of 
threads based on relevancy. See the idea is to index message data in the thread 
documents and then boost the message mutlivalued field over the thread title 
and thread description (which in my opinion, would give better results).

The user, when presented with the thread results, could then drill down into a 
particular thread's messages using the same search terms on the message index 
(but filtered by the referring thread id)
